The Tuesday after Thanksgiving is intended to create a national movement around the holidays dedicated to giving.

UNC Lineberger Comprehensive Cancer Center is once again taking part in #GivingTuesday, a yearly effort to harness the collective power of a unique blend of partners—charities, families, businesses and individuals—to transform how people think about, talk about and participate in the giving season.

Taking place December 2, 2014—the Tuesday after Thanksgiving—#GivingTuesday coincides with the kickoff of the holiday shopping season and will harness the power of social media to create a national movement around the holidays dedicated to giving.

An official partner of the #GivingTuesday movement, UNC Lineberger relies on the private support of more than 6,560 donors to advance cancer research, care, education and prevention in North Carolina and beyond.

Seeing an opportunity to channel the generous spirit of the holiday season to inspire action around charitable giving, a group of friends and partners, led by the 92nd Street Y, came together to find ways to promote and celebrate the great tradition of American giving. #GivingTuesday has brought together thought leaders in the non-profit sector to discuss innovative ways that people are approaching giving during challenging economic times, along with how Americans can give smarter and use new media to encourage positive change in their communities.
